Transaction 2558402ecee5948302d5647e673b77a5b8a28c6016f1a048992c10ec357b00ab

2 Input
1 Outputs
  • 2558402ecee5948302d5647e673b77a5b8a28c6016f1a048992c10ec357b00ab:0
  • value  809647
    address  1C33CS6Auk1GUdNnyG6nRgCYnGoUWLPTNH